How does Push to Talk work?

Push-to-talk, push to talk, or PTT, works by facilitating conversations across various communications lines. A push-to-talk switch or button is used to switch users from voice mode to transmit mode.

Why doesn t push to talk work?

Make sure push-to-talk and push-to-mute aren't bound under the same key. Make sure your headset is set as the default input/output device in both Discord and your PC. Scroll to the bottom and click Reset Voice Settings. Try to send an audio message on Discord by PTT to see if it works.

What is push to talk vs push-to-mute?

Push-to-mute means the mic is always unmuted, unless you are holding down the mute button. Push-to-talk is the opposite: the mic is always muted, unless you are holding down the mute button. This example assumes that the mic mute switch is a momentary switch.

What is the difference between voice activity and push to talk?

Discord allows users of its desktop application to choose from two voice input modes: “Voice Activity” and “Push to Talk.” The Voice Activity setting will cause the app to automatically transmit the user's voice as they're speaking, while the Push to Talk setting will require users to press a key to transmit their ...

What button do I use for push to talk?

One of the most popular keys for push to talk is the mouse 4 or 5 buttons or the side buttons as they are often called. These buttons are easy to reach, keep your hand free for keyboard movement and don't interfere with any of your keybinds for actions within the game.

What is the meaning of push to talk?

Definition(s):

A method of communicating on half-duplex communication lines, including two-way radio, using a “walkie-talkie” button to switch from voice reception to transmit mode.
